PHIL-240 Biomedical Ethics

3 cr.
The course examines ethical theories against the reality of current issues in the medical professions and in the fields of bio-research. Topics such as euthanasia, genetic experimentation, informed consent, abortion and human and animal experimentation are studied from widely different ethical perspectives. 
Prerequisites: ENGL-095  and RDNG-099   or appropriate Accuplacer scores
Offered: Fall
